How To Make Corner Bakery’s Apple Walnut Pancakes

Warm & fluffy pancakes with chunks of fresh apples and toasty walnuts.

Preparation: 15 minutes
Cooking: 15 minutes
Total: 30 minutes

Serves:

Ingredients

  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• ¼ cup granulated sugar
  • 2 tsp baking powder
  • 1 tsp baking soda
  • ½ tsp salt
  • 2 eggs
  • 2 cups buttermilk
  • 1 tsp pure vanilla extract
  • 1 cup chopped apples
  • ½ cup chopped walnuts
  • Unsalted butter, for cooking

Instructions

  1. In a large bowl, whisk together flour, sugar, baking powder, baking soda, and salt.

  2. In a separate bowl beat the eggs lightly, then whisk in buttermilk and vanilla extract.

  3. Make a well in the center of the dry ingredients and pour in the wet mixture, stirring until just combined.

  4. Fold in chopped apples and walnuts.

  5. Heat a griddle or non-stick fry pan over medium-high heat.

  6. Add a small amount of butter and let it melt. Pour ¼ cup of batter for each pancake, and cook until bubbles form on the surface, then flip and cook the other side.

  7. Repeat until all the batter is gone.
